
The Akwa Ibom State House of Assembly on Thursday confirmed eight Commissioners and Special Adviser nominees forwarded to it by Governor Udom Emmanuel.
Recall that the House had on July 16, 2023, at plenary, received a letter from Governor Udom Emmanuel, requesting it to confirm eight persons for appointment as Commissioners and Special Advisers into the State Executive Council.
The eight confirmed persons were: Prof. Eno Ibanga, Hon. Frank Archibong, Prof. Augustine Umoh, Dr. (Ms) Ini Adiakpan, Mrs Enobong Mbobo, Barr. Ini Emembong Essien, Elder (Hon.) Amanam Nkanga and Dr. Imo Moffat.
Presenting the report, Chairman of the House Committee on Judiciary, Justice, Human Rights and Public Petitions Hon. Victor Ekwere, revealed that the credentials and other relevant documents of the nominees were carefully screened, and the nominees were discovered to be intelligent men and women of proven integrity.
Ekwere said the Committee never received negative report against the nominees adding that they have all met the constitutional requirements for appointment as Commissioners as outlined in Section 192 (4) and 106 of the 1999 Constitution of the Federal Republic of Nigeria as amended.
He commended Governor Emmanuel for selecting men and women of proven integrity into the State Executive Council and advised that the careers, academic qualifications, experiences and specialisation of the nominees should be considered in assigning portfolios to the nominees.
Speaker of the House, Rt. Hon. Aniekan Bassey, in his remarks, directed the Clerk, Mrs Mandu Umoren to communicate the resolution of the House to the Governor for further action.
